i?m doing exactly that with my desktop and my laptop for a couple of years now.

I do the main development work on my fast desktop with multiple screens and I use my laptop being on site.

All the files are in the OneDrive cloud and replicated locally to both the desktop and laptop.

This works fairly well if you allow the time for the update to/from the cloud when files change.

The main reason i?m running into issues is when I did updates on-site and then packing up the laptop without letting it do the updates to the cloud and then opening the project at the desktop and wondering what happened to the updates I did¡­

Hi All,

I'm setting up a new desktop and laptop, and am planning to reconfigure how I deal with file structure and backup.

I'm leaning toward OneDrive, but know that I need to do work on files that are locally sourced vs in the cloud.

My thought is that both my DT and LT will have all the files primarily local, and just push changes to the cloud so that the other machine will have any updated files when it needs them.

1. What are your experiences or suggestions regarding this approach with OneDrive

?

2. Any other non-tweeky solutions that others are using for this
